Subject: Rotation done — Vaultspin master key swapped

Hi future folks, this morning we rotated the credential that Vaultspin itself uses to talk to the internal policy store. Ironic that the rotation tool needed a manual rotation, I know — there's a backlog item to make it self-rotating. Old key is revoked as of now, and all three environments were verified green. For your config updates, the new key follows.

API key for yahig-tadup: kto7_ubizbYm

## Ownership

SpokeShift is the rebalancing engine for the Pedalune bike-share network in Varmouth. It computes dock-level surplus targets nightly and pushes van routes to the Loadrunner dispatch queue. Releases are cut from the `stable` branch only; hotfixes require a signed tag. Do not ship without a green run of the depot simulation suite. Config changes to the demand model must be reviewed before tagging. All release questions, escalations, and sign-offs go to the person named below.

approver of yajef-fajef = Oliwyn Silion Kasok Kasox

## Alert: StatRelay Sidecar Flush Lag

This alert fires when the StatRelay metrics-aggregation sidecar falls more than 120 seconds behind on flushing buffered samples to the Coalmine backend. Plugin-emitted counters are buffered in-process, so sustained lag usually means a plugin is emitting unbounded label cardinality or blocking the flush thread. Check your plugin's metric registration against the published cardinality limits before escalating. If the lag persists after your plugin is ruled out, contact the telemetry team.

escalation mailbox, bagug-fahof: novdor.wendor.jormir@norvalabs.example